1 : Explore Ludwigsburg Residential Palace [2 hrs]
Visit the stunning Ludwigsburg Residential Palace, one of the largest Baroque palaces in Germany. Wander through the ornately furnished rooms, beautiful gardens, and the charming porcelain museum. Don’t miss the intricate details of the Palace Church and the impressive fountain in the center of the courtyard.
2 : Stroll around Ludwigsburg Market Square [1 hr]
Take a leisurely walk through Ludwigsburg’s historic Market Square, lined with colorful buildings, quaint cafes, and local shops. Admire the impressive town hall, Altes Rathaus, and the charming fountain at the center of the square. Enjoy the lively atmosphere and maybe even pick up some souvenirs.
3 : Visit Favorite Park [2 hrs]
Spend some time relaxing in Ludwigsburg’s beautiful Favorite Park, a sprawling green oasis with manicured lawns, serene lakes, and picturesque walking paths. Explore the charming Belvedere and the fairy-tale-like Monrepos Castle within the park. Take a boat ride on the lake or have a picnic amidst nature.
4 : Discover Ludwigsburg Baroque Christmas Market [2 hrs]
During the festive season, don’t miss the Ludwigsburg Baroque Christmas Market, one of Germany’s most enchanting markets. Experience the magical atmosphere with glittering lights, traditional crafts, delicious treats, and festive music. Warm up with a cup of mulled wine and enjoy the Christmas spirit.
5 : Explore Blooming Baroque Gardens [1.5 hrs]
Walk through the Blooming Baroque Gardens, a floral paradise with vibrant flowerbeds, intricate sculptures, and peaceful water features. Admire the seasonal displays, from tulips in spring to dahlias in autumn. Relax in the tranquil surroundings and take in the beauty of nature.
6 : Shop at the Marstall Center [1 hr]
Indulge in some retail therapy at the Marstall Center, Ludwigsburg’s premier shopping destination. Browse a variety of shops offering fashion, accessories, home decor, and more. Discover local brands and international retailers, and enjoy a coffee break at one of the trendy cafes in the center.
Background Info
Weather
Ludwigsburg experiences mild temperatures with average highs ranging from 2°C in winter to 25°C in summer. Rainfall is evenly distributed throughout the year, with occasional showers. Humidity levels are moderate, and air quality is generally good.
Language
German is the primary language spoken in Ludwigsburg.
Cost Of Living
Ludwigsburg has a moderate cost of living index, with affordable housing and transportation compared to major cities in Germany.
Other
Ludwigsburg is known for its rich cultural heritage, especially in Baroque architecture and festive events such as the Baroque Christmas Market. The city offers a mix of historical sites, green spaces, and modern amenities for visitors to enjoy.
